Audi TT MPG
EPA fuel economy for 12 Audi TT trims sold from 2019 to 2023. Best ever: 26 MPG (2022 TT Coupe quattro). Latest model year 2023: 25 MPG combined across 2 trims.

Audi TT MPG by year
| Year | Best combined | City | Hwy | Best trim that year | Trims |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 25 | 23 | 30 | TT Coupe, 2.0 L, 4 cyl, Auto (AM-S7) | 2 |
| 2022 | 26 | 23 | 30 | TT Coupe quattro, 2.0 L, 4 cyl, Auto (AM-S7) | 2 |
| 2021 | 26 | 23 | 31 | TT Coupe quattro, 2.0 L, 4 cyl, Auto (AM-S7) | 3 |
| 2020 | 26 | 23 | 31 | TT Coupe quattro, 2.0 L, 4 cyl, Auto (AM-S7) | 3 |
| 2019 | 26 | 23 | 31 | TT Coupe quattro, 2.0 L, 4 cyl, Auto (AM-S7) | 2 |
Every Audi TT trim
| Year | Trim | Engine | Transmission | Drive | Fuel | City | Hwy | Comb | CO2 g/mi | Fuel cost/yr |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| TT Coupe |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 30 | 25 | 347 | $2,500 |
| 2023 | TT Roadster |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 30 | 25 | 347 | $2,500 |
| 2022 | TT Coupe qu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 30 | 26 | 346 | $2,400 |
| 2022 | TT Roadster qu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 30 | 26 | 346 | $2,400 |
| 2021 | TT Coupe qu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 31 | 26 | 344 | $2,400 |
| 2021 | TT Roadster qu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 31 | 26 | 344 | $2,400 |
| 2021 | TT RS | 2.5 L, 5 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Premium | 20 | 30 | 24 | 373 | $3,230 |
| 2020 | TT Coupe qu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 31 | 26 | 340 | $2,400 |
| 2020 | TT Roadster qu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 31 | 26 | 340 | $2,400 |
| 2020 | TT RS | 2.5 L, 5 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Premium | 19 | 29 | 23 | 387 | $3,370 |
| 2019 | TT Coupe qu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 31 | 26 | 340 | $2,400 |
| 2019 | TT Roadster quattro | 2.0 L, 4 cyl | Auto (AM-S7) | AWD | Regular | 23 | 31 | 26 | 340 | $2,400 |
CO2 is tailpipe grams per mile from the EPA test. Fuel cost per year uses the prices and miles in the calculator above (the EPA's own prices and 15,000 miles a year until you change them); blank when the fuel has no price here (hydrogen, natural gas).

Questions people ask
What is the best MPG for a Audi TT?
The most efficient Audi TT the EPA has rated is the 2022 TT Coupe quattro at 26 MPG combined (23 city, 30 highway).
What MPG does the 2023 Audi TT get?
Every 2023 Audi TT trim is rated 25 MPG combined.
Which Audi TT has the worst fuel economy?
The 2020 TT RS is the lowest rated at 23 MPG combined.
